Undelying situation: I have to test an application providing a HTML user interface. This ui can - of course - be reached using any web browser. In addition there is a client application (standard windows) containing an embedded browser control (internet explorer).

Tests should cover the functionalities provided by the HTML ui both using (i) different web browsers AND (ii) the client application with embedded browser.

Regarding the test object hierarchy within the test object repository, the top object (the entry point) would be (i) Browser(...) respectively (ii)a Window(...) object.

Could anybody imagine how to create a generic TO model to use in both scenarios?
